Definition

"Axes" is the plural form of the noun "axis," which refers to a straight line around which an object rotates, or in mathematics, a reference line used in graphs. Additionally, "axes" can also refer to tools with a heavy bladed head mounted across a handle, primarily used for chopping, splitting, or cutting wood.
